NOVA Wales

From December 2025, NOVA Wales will operate a core service focused on veterans living in South Wales. Once this has been established, the intention is to roll out nationally, providing an equitable service to those available in Scotland and England.

Most former serving personnel adapt well to civilian life, but for some, factors such as poor physical or mental health, homelessness, debt, health issues, PTSD, or alcohol, drug or gambling misuse can lead them into contact with the justice system. These issues can surface at any stage, from service discharge to much later on in life.

This is where we step in. As leading providers of justice sector services to the veteran community, we know that specialist support and intervention are proven to generate positive outcomes for individuals involved, as well as the justice sector and the local community.

NOVA Wales’s life-changing – and often lifesaving – support helps veterans in the justice system to address their underlying issues, rebuild their lives and fulfil their potential.

NOVA Wales is funded by the Armed Forces Covenant Fund Trust.

Our brand-new NOVA Wales team is working closely with South Wales police, HMPPS, healthcare organisations, and the local Armed Forces community to identify, engage and support Welsh veterans in the justice system.
